Many many errands to run before i can peacefully relax and enjoy my holiday but i will quickly post my amazing potato wedges recipe first
Potatoes: 4 to 5 cut into wedges and soak them cold water for 10minutes so that they don’t stick to each other when u bake them.
Preheat the oven and bake them with a drizzle of sunflower oil.
It will take around 20 minutes for them to bake, take them out and coat them with chillipowder and salt.
A very simple dish indeed!!!
